Get StartedA solar-powered air conditioner is a cooling system that utilizes solar energy to power its compressor and other essential components like fans. These systems collect solar energy through panels, converting it into electricity to power the air conditioner.

An environmental activist since the 1970s, he is also a historian, author, gardener, and educator. Solar air conditioning is any air conditioning powered by the sun's energy. Solar air conditioners have no emissions and supply their own energy, so customers can lessen their carbon footprint and reduce their energy costs at the same time.
We found that the investment in a solar AC generally pays for itself within 10 years of purchase. Angi reports the average homeowner spends $3,400 on a solar air conditioner. In general, they cost $1,600-13,000. Mini splits are more affordable, while solar-powered central air conditioners cost more.
